How Our Ice Maker Line Leak Water Removal Process Works
We understand that a proper process is crucial when dealing with water damage. That’s why our team follows a meticulous step-by-step approach to ensure your property is restored to its original state. From initial assessment to final inspection, we’ll keep you informed every step of the way.
Step 1: Emergency Response
We’ll arrive within 60 minutes to assess the damage and start the extraction process. Our team will carefully evaluate the affected area to find out the best course of action.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use industrial-grade pumps to remove standing water and moisture from the area.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your property back to normal.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the area and prevent mold growth. Our team will carefully monitor the drying process to ensure everything is d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
We’ll th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area to prevent bacterial growth and odors. Our team will use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ure everything is restored to its original state. Our team will make any necessary touch-ups to guarantee your satisfaction.

How do I prevent Ice Maker Line Leaks?
Regular maintenance is key to preventing Ice Maker Line Leaks. Check your ice maker line regularly for signs of wear and tear, and replace it if necessary. You should also ensure proper installation and regular cleaning to prevent clogs and leaks.
